In this episode, Heather and Kerissa chat with Clare Truman.
Clare Truman is an education consultant, author, PhD student, and big sister to an autistic young man. She specializes in supporting PDA children and young people to access education.

She is the author of ‘The Teacher’s Guide to Pathological Demand Avoidance: Essential Strategies for the Classroom’ published by Jessica Kingsley Publishers in 2021, and is currently completing a PhD exploring the educational experiences of PDA children and young people.

Clare has taught in mainstream schools, specialist schools, and alternative education settings. Now, through Spectrum Space, Clare provides distance learning packages for children and young people who cannot access school and supports professionals and families through training and consultancy to better meet the needs of PDA children and young people.
